How to Treat Constipation Without Meds

Consume two cups of fruit a day. Trade in unhealthy and high calorie sweets for fresh fruit, like apples, bananas and grapes, to help combat constipation.

Up your vegetable intake. Increase your intake of vegetables to add fiber to your diet and help resolve constipation without medication. Good choices include lettuce, broccoli and green beans.

Drink more water. Get rid of constipation fast by keeping your intestinal tract hydrated. Aim for eight glasses of water a day to maintain soft stools, according to the Doctor's Book of Home Remedies.

Take supplements. Buy fiber supplements and take as directed to relieve constipation.

Move your body. Explore different ways to get active, such as aerobic exercise, dance, walking or bicycling, to increase intestinal contractions.

Experiment with massages. Relieve constipation in children by gently massaging their stomach to promote intestinal movements.
